Get the babies and toddlers moving to music!
Join us for a fun morning of music and movement for our youngest customers with local musician and Enrichment Collective’s founder, Stef Pleasure!
Ms. Stef has 30 years of experience as a music teacher and performer and specializes in infant/toddler and preschool music and movement.
This program is for babies, toddler and preschool-aged children. Adult must accompany children under 8 years of age.
The Enrichment Collective believes in the power of creativity, movement and cultural exploration to inspire young minds. They are a team of expert educators, artists and instructors specializing in music, art, dance, yoga and Spanish enrichment for preschoolers. They bring engaging, hands-on learning experiences directly to preschools and early childhood programs. They are dedicated to Inspiring Creativity and Unlocking Imagination through high quality enrichment programs that nurture confidence, curiosity and self-expression.
